bookcase a set of shelves for holding books.
fact something known or proved to be true.
fist a hand with the fingers bent under tight.
hallway a narrow passage in a house or building; corridor.
human having to do with or belonging to people.
peak the highest part of a mountain, or the highest part of anything.
pen a long, thin tool used for writing or drawing in ink.
sailor a member of the navy who works aboard a ship.
seem to appear to be or do.
silver a shiny, soft, white metal that is valuable and used to make jewelry and coins.
spit1 to force saliva or something else from the mouth.
storm a violent event in weather. In a storm, there may be a lot of rain, snow, or wind.
suck to pull into the mouth by using the tongue and lips.
think to judge or reason about something.
trim to make neat by cutting away some parts.
